President Aliyev Honors Turkish Heroes on July 15 Coup Attempt Anniversary

Baku: President Ilham Aliyev has sent a condolence letter to the President of the Republic of Trkiye, Recep Tayyip Erdogan, on the anniversary of the July 15, 2016 coup attempt, APA reports.

According to Azeri-Press News Agency, the letter from President Aliyev expressed deep respect for the martyrs who sacrificed their lives during the thwarting of the coup attempt in Trkiye. He conveyed his deepest condolences to the families of the fallen and to the people of Trkiye. Aliyev highlighted the historical significance of the event, marking it as both tragic and honorable, emphasizing the role of the Turkish people in defending their homeland against threats to statehood and democracy.

The letter praised the decisive leadership of President Erdogan and the unity of the Turkish people, which were crucial in overcoming the challenges of that night. Aliyev noted that Trkiye emerged stronger from the crisis, showcasing its commitment to national will and statehood traditions. He acknowledged "Democracy and National Unity Day," celebrated annually on July 15, as a symbol of Turkish national solidarity and resilience.

President Aliyev reaffirmed the strong ties between Azerbaijan and Trkiye, guided by the principle of "One nation, two states." He assured that Azerbaijan stood by Trkiye during the crisis and emphasized the enduring brotherhood and unity between the two nations. Aliyev expressed confidence in the continued strengthening of Azerbaijani-Turkish relations and their strategic alliance through joint efforts.

The letter concluded with Aliyev extending wishes of robust health, happiness, and success to President Erdogan, along with peace, tranquility, prosperity, and welfare to the Republic of Trkiye.
